YouTube: Choose a Better Thumbnail Image
YouTube August 7th, 2007 - By HaochiThis is not unusual, you upload your video to YouTube (especially Google Video), everything goes smooth and great, until you found that the thumbnail image is blank/blurry/terrible looking. You can avoid that by doing some clever tricks, but again, most people on YouTube don’t have time/skill to do that.
Now YouTube makes it simple/possible. To change the thumbnail image, just click on the “Edit Video Info” button next to the video you want to make the change in the My Videos page, then choose one of the three YouTube-generated thumbnails to “represent your video in search results and other displays.”
You can’t upload your own thumbnail image yet, but as the proverb says, “something is better than nothing.” :)
